JAMES DWAIN CODY is a motor carrier based in ADONA, AR registered with the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ration under USDOT number 3016565 and MC number 32025. The company has been registered with the FMCSA since June 2017, a span of roughly 9 years. JAMES DWAIN CODY reports a fleet of 7 power units and 4 drivers to the FMCSA. Cargo carried includes General Freight, Metal: Sheets, Coils, Rolls, Logs, Poles, Beams, Lumber, and Building Materials. Over the past 24 months, FMCSA records show 8 inspections with a driver out-of-service rate of 0% and 1 reported crash. Recent inspections have been recorded in AR, CO, CT, MO, NC, NM, OK, and PA. Operating authority is active for: common carrier.
